What companies run services between Coimbra, Portugal and Amora, Portugal?

Comboios de Portugal operates a train from Coimbra-B to Lisboa Oriente hourly. Tickets cost €8–27 and the journey takes 1h 39m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Terminal Rodoviário de Coimbra to Miratejo Alameda 25 Abril 11 via Estação Rodoviária de Sete Rios and Sete Rios in around 3h 29m.
